Senior Hardware Engineer – Network Technology and Design, SerDes

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ams within software, mechanical, and manufacturing to ensure successful integration of network technologies into ECU electrical designs.
  • Perform detailed hardware analysis, including worst-case analysis, signal integrity, and power integrity, for SerDes and Ethernet interfaces and related circuitry.
  • Troubleshoot hardware issues, perform root cause analysis, and implement robust, long-term solutions across ECUs and associated connectivity hardware.
  • Conduct design reviews and provide constructive feedback to ensure high-quality, manufacturable designs that meet performance, safety, and reliability targets.
  • Develop hardware requirements and test specifications for SerDes/Ethernet connectivity and supporting circuitry.
  • Develop a clear test strategy covering all aspects of development, from component and board-level validation through system integration and production readiness.
  • Lead bench test execution throughout the development lifecycle, including bring-up, characterization, and debug of prototype and production-intent hardware.
  • Establish domain expertise for semiconductors and ECU product lines within your scope of responsibility, with focus on wired connectivity technology (SerDes and Ethernet PHYs, switches, and related components).
  • Manage technology roadmaps in close collaboration with industry leaders and semiconductor partners to ensure GM’s network hardware solutions remain on the forefront of performance, cost, and scalability.

Requirements

  • BS in Electrical Engineering / Electronics / Computer Science
  • 5+ total years of engineering experience at an OEM, OR at a semiconductor supplier, OR at a Tier 1 ECU supplier
  • 3+ years of engineering experience in electronic hardware design and development
  • Working knowledge of automotive electronic hardware and automotive software architecture
  • Strong proficiency in circuit design, schematic creation, and PCB layout
  • Experience in hardware design tools such as Mentor Graphics Xpedition and ORCAD
  • Experience with lab equipment such as power supplies, oscilloscopes, signal generators, and multimeters
  • Exceptional demonstrated experience leading projects to completion
